What is Global Topical Drugs Glass Packaging Market?

The Global Topical Drugs Glass Packaging Market refers to the industry that focuses on the production and distribution of glass containers specifically designed for topical medications. These medications are applied directly to the skin or mucous membranes to treat various conditions, such as infections, inflammations, and skin disorders. Glass packaging is preferred in this market due to its inert nature, which ensures that the medication remains stable and uncontaminated. Additionally, glass is impermeable and non-reactive, making it an ideal material for preserving the efficacy and shelf life of topical drugs. The market encompasses a wide range of glass packaging solutions, including bottles, jars, ampoules, and vials, each tailored to meet the specific needs of different topical formulations. The demand for glass packaging in this sector is driven by the increasing prevalence of skin-related ailments, advancements in pharmaceutical formulations, and the growing awareness of the benefits of using glass over other materials. As a result, the Global Topical Drugs Glass Packaging Market is witnessing significant growth, with manufacturers continuously innovating to provide more efficient and user-friendly packaging solutions.

Liquid Medicine, Solid Medicine, Semi-Solid Medicine in the Global Topical Drugs Glass Packaging Market:

In the context of the Global Topical Drugs Glass Packaging Market, medications can be broadly categorized into liquid, solid, and semi-solid forms, each requiring specific types of glass packaging to ensure their stability and effectiveness. Liquid medicines, such as lotions, solutions, and suspensions, are commonly packaged in glass bottles or ampoules. These containers are designed to protect the liquid from contamination and degradation caused by exposure to air, light, and moisture. The use of glass ensures that the liquid medication remains pure and effective throughout its shelf life. Solid medicines, including powders and tablets, are often stored in glass jars or vials. These containers provide a robust barrier against environmental factors that could compromise the integrity of the solid form, such as humidity and temperature fluctuations. Glass packaging also prevents any chemical interactions between the medication and the container, preserving the drug's potency. Semi-solid medicines, such as creams, ointments, and gels, are typically packaged in glass jars or tubes. These containers are designed to facilitate easy application while maintaining the stability of the semi-solid formulation. Glass packaging for semi-solid medicines ensures that the product remains uncontaminated and retains its therapeutic properties over time. The choice of glass packaging for these different forms of medication is influenced by several factors, including the nature of the drug, its sensitivity to environmental conditions, and the need for precise dosing. Manufacturers in the Global Topical Drugs Glass Packaging Market are continually innovating to develop packaging solutions that meet the specific requirements of each type of medication, ensuring that patients receive safe and effective treatments.
